概括
一个新的,简单的步骤测试准确地估计了儿童和青少年的心肺呼吸能力 (VO2max). 这种低成本的工具为临床实践提供了一种可靠的方法来评估儿科健康.
科学领域:
- 儿科运动生理学 运动生理学
- 心血管健康评估评估
- 生物识别测量验证验证
背景情况:
- 心血管健康 (VO2max) 是儿科的关键健康指标和死亡率预测指标.
- 临床评估VO2max受到高成本,专业设备和专家人员要求的阻碍.
- 需要一种简单的,低成本的方法来估计儿童和青少年的VO2max,用于例行临床使用.
研究的目的:
- 验证和评估一个子最大步骤测试的可靠性,以估计儿童群体 (8-16岁) 的VO2max.
- 开发一种新的VO2max预测方程,使用步骤测试中容易获得的变量.
- 建立一个实用和可访问的工具,用于临床评估青年心肺健康.
主要方法:
- 这是一项涉及242名儿童和青少年 (8-16岁) 的横截面研究.
- 通过最大跑步机增量测试 (黄金标准) 测量心肺呼吸能力.
- 下最大步骤测试方案 (3分钟22步/分钟) 记录心率;计算BMIz-score.
主要成果:
- 从步骤测试中预测的VO2max与测量VO2max之间发现了强烈的相关性 (r=0.86,p<0.001).
- 布兰德-阿尔特曼分析证实了预测和测量VO2max值之间的统计一致性.
- 开发并验证了一种新的预测方程,该方程包含了第三分钟的心率,体重和身高.
结论:
- 经过验证的步骤测试协议是估计8至16岁儿童和青少年VO2max的可靠和准确方法.
- 开发的预测方程适用于临床应用,为评估儿科心肺呼吸能力提供了低成本的替代方案.
- 这种简单的测试可以促进儿童群体的常规查和心肺呼吸系统健康监测.
